Technology Encyclopedia Home >How does the risk assessment engine support multilingual data?

How does the risk assessment engine support multilingual data?

The risk assessment engine supports multilingual data through several key mechanisms, ensuring accurate analysis and decision-making across diverse linguistic inputs.

  1. Language Detection & Normalization
    The engine first identifies the language of input data (e.g., text, logs, or user queries) using built-in language detection algorithms. It then normalizes the text (e.g., converting accents, handling special characters) to standardize processing. For example, a risk assessment system analyzing customer feedback from multiple regions would detect whether the input is in Spanish, French, or Mandarin before further analysis.

  2. Multilingual NLP Models
    It integrates natural language processing (NLP) models trained on multilingual corpora (e.g., multilingual BERT or similar architectures). These models understand context, sentiment, and risk indicators across languages. For instance, detecting phishing attempts in emails written in German or identifying fraudulent transactions described in Japanese.

  3. Translation & Localization (Optional)
    If needed, the engine can leverage machine translation to convert non-primary-language data into a standardized language (e.g., English) for unified risk scoring. However, this is often avoided to preserve nuance. Example: A global e-commerce platform assesses reviews in 10+ languages without translation by using language-specific risk rules.

  4. Localized Risk Rules & Thresholds
    Risk criteria are adapted per language/culture. For example, certain keywords or transaction patterns may indicate higher risk in one country but not another. The engine applies locale-specific thresholds.

  5. Data Encoding & Compatibility
    It ensures compatibility with various character encodings (UTF-8, GB18030, etc.) to process scripts like Cyrillic, Arabic, or Kanji without corruption.

Example: A financial institution uses a risk assessment engine to monitor transactions globally. When a user from Brazil submits a high-value transfer, the engine detects Portuguese text in the description, analyzes it using a Portuguese-trained NLP model, and flags it based on local fraud patterns—without translating the content.

For scalable multilingual data processing, Tencent Cloud’s NLP and AI services (like Tencent Cloud Natural Language Processing or Multilingual Text Analysis) can enhance such engines with pre-trained multilingual models and high-performance computing.